Patrick Hunn is a writer, editor and journalist based in Melbourne interested in the internet, money, cities and culture. He is originally from Wellington and holds an MA in Creative Writing from the International Institute of Modern Letters at Victoria University of Wellington and an MA in International Journalism from City, University of London. He is the associate editor of ArchitectureAU.
